Summary

The 2026 NHL Draft is set for June 26-27 in Buffalo, New York. The Pittsburgh Penguins currently have five draft picks, including three in the first two rounds. They hold Round 1, Pick 22, Round 2, Pick 39 (acquired from Winnipeg), Round 2, Pick 54, Round 3, Pick 86, and Round 6, Pick 170 (acquired from Nashville). The Penguins' selection order may change due to potential trades before or during the draft. The team has highlighted a strong presence in terms of draft capital for upcoming years.
